How to Adjust Iced Pour-Over Coffee Parameters? A Full Breakdown of Water Temperature, Ratio, Grind Size, and Bean Selection
Iced pour-over coffee is not simply about pouring hot coffee over ice cubes; it requires targeted adjustments in the coffee-to-water ratio, grind size, water temperature, and pouring method, otherwise it is very easy to end up with a brew that tastes as weak as ice water. Starting from Front Street's hands-on experience, this article first explains the root cause of flavorless iced pour-over—both concentration and extraction yield are too low—and then explains one by one how the parameters change as the water amount is reduced: the coffee-to-water ratio is tightened from 1:15 for hot brewing to 1:10, the grind is made finer by 1–2 settings, the passing rate through a No. 20 sieve increases by about 5%, and staged pouring is used to extend the extraction time to make up for the loss of efficiency caused by the reduced water amount. The article also gives direction on bean selection: natural and anaerobic processing suit rich flavors, while washed processing suits a fresh and clean taste, and it includes Front Street's complete iced pour-over recipe for Ethiopia Hamashu for reference. Can Espresso Beans Be Brewed as Pour-Over? A Full Analysis of Blend, Single-Origin, and SOE Characteristics and Brewing Parameters
Many coffee enthusiasts are curious: can espresso beans be used for pour-over? The answer is of course yes, but between "can brew" and "tastes good" lies a gulf of parameters. Espresso beans are usually roasted darker, with the aim of balancing the acidity and bitterness for both milk coffee and espresso. If you directly apply the parameters for light-roast pour-over beans, it is very easy to over-extract. This article starts with the differences in roasting, explains the respective characteristics of espresso blend beans, single-origin pour-over beans, and SOE, and, using Front Street Coffee's Huakui and Strawberry Candy Espresso as examples, provides pour-over adjustment plans for medium-roast espresso beans—lowering the water temperature and coarsening the grind—so as to brew a balanced, full-bodied coffee with a long, lingering finish.
